Handover for the Torvane event pipeline: all producers must register schemas with the Lattice registry before publishing. Compatibility mode is backward-transitive, so removing fields requires a deprecation cycle of at least two releases. Consumers pin schema versions in config; never bump them without checking downstream owners. I've left notes on pending migrations in the tracker. The registry onboarding guide is on the page below.

operations page: https://jenkins.zemvarcloud.local/job/merge_requests/repo/build/73930b4b30f0a8ed

## Further reading

The fuel-usage report in this module aggregates per-vehicle consumption from the Harthaven telemetry feed, normalizing by route segment before rollup. Reviewers should pay particular attention to the idle-burn estimation logic, which has historically been a source of subtle rounding errors. The assumptions behind the normalization constants, along with worked examples, are maintained on the internal design page linked below.

runbook for tajep-yahig: https://artifactory.lumictech.corp/repo

**Vendored fonts — signing policy**

Lintfall vendors all third-party fonts into `assets/fonts/vendored`. No CDN fetches at build time. Each font bundle is hashed, recorded in `fonts.lock`, and signed before it enters the artifact store. Rebuilds with unsigned bundles fail CI. To add a font: drop the files in, run `fontpack verify`, then `fontpack sign`. Contractors sign with the shared vendoring key, rotated quarterly by the build team. The current key follows.

rollout seal: bky9_PeXH1fTLY

Quickview is Brindlecore's diff viewer for files over 50MB. Plugins hook the chunk pipeline, not the render layer. Register your extension in quickview.plugins.toml, declare max chunk size, and return diffs as line-range tuples. Never buffer the whole file; the host will kill you at 2GB. Sample plugins live in the starter repo. Questions from external authors go to the plugin desk.

pager mailbox: druwyn@norvaio.corp